Franklin (Tenn.) four-star offensive lineman Max Wray is the No. 4 offensive tackle in the 2018 class. He's a big-time player, and a former Georgia commit.
This week, Wray announced a top 4 of Tennessee, LSU, Alabama and Ohio State. His 247Sports Crystal Ball has indicated he is a strong Alabama lean, but a brand new prediction has turned some heads.
247Sports College Football Insider and Director of Scouting Barton Simmons has Crystal Ball'd Wray to Ohio State. The Buckeyes hosted the 6-foot-6, 289-pound recruit on an unofficial visit last weekend.
Did OSU do enough to sway Wray? We'll find out soon enough, as Wray intends to announce a decision by the middle of next month.
